[OPEN-ILS-GENERAL] New install problem with settings

2010-12-16 Thread Vicki Reeves
We are a parish (think county) library with 5 branches trying to migrate
from a vendor system into Evergreen.  While our library materials will
need to be assigned to the branches, our patron database is shared by
all branches.  Does anyone have experience with this setup who might
tell us how the system should be configured so that this can happen?
Thank you.



Re: [OPEN-ILS-GENERAL] New install problem with settings

2010-12-16 Thread Deanna Frazee
Our patrons are assigned to the parent organization (Killeen City
Library System) so that they can check out at any of our locations.
Materials are assigned to a shelving location, so they show up as Main
Mystery or CMB Nonfiction.  Does that make sense?

Re: [OPEN-ILS-GENERAL] New install problem with settings

2010-12-16 Thread Vicki Reeves
I think so.  If I used this, all of our patrons and all of our items
would belong to the main branch and we would use the shelving location
to show where each item is being housed as in 'Mid-City branch fiction'
or 'East-Side Branch picture books'.  Is that correct?

If so, my next question is how does this affect circulation statistics?
Would I still be able to ask for a count of items checked out at
Mid-City branch?

Thank you.

Re: [OPEN-ILS-GENERAL] New install problem with settings

2010-12-16 Thread Mary Toma
We have 4 branches.  Our patron cards work in any branch and we can pull
statistics for each branch - circulation statistics as well as patron
statistics.  When patrons are registered they are assigned a home library.
Sorry, I don't know the hows and wherefores of the setup but I know it
works.
